Cinder Cinder, located in North Fitzroy within the historic Terminus Hotel, offers traditional fine dining with a modern Australian menu featuring wood-fired dishes prepared on the Josper Grill. The warm and inviting atmosphere is complemented by rich teal and burnt orange decor, creating the perfect setting for any occasion. For an unforgettable culinary experience, try the Chef's Table with a surprise menu tailored to each visit. Located on Queens Street, Cinder is a must-visit for those who appreciate cooking with flame and fire.

Cinder by Jake Furst is a must-visit restaurant for anyone who loves the unique and delicious taste of flame-cooked food. Located in the historic Terminus Hotel in North Fitzroy, Cinder offers a warm and inviting atmosphere with its teal and burnt orange decor that perfectly complements the exposed bluestone walls.

The star of the show at Cinder is undoubtedly their Josper Grill, which infuses every dish with the unmistakable flavor of cooking over fire. The modern Australian menu is expertly crafted to showcase the best of local ingredients, and there's something for everyone on offer.

Whether you're looking for a romantic night out or a casual dinner with friends, Cinder welcomes all people for all occasions. And if you're feeling particularly adventurous, be sure to try out the Chef's Table experience where you'll be treated to a unique culinary journey with no menus and no two visits ever being quite the same.

Overall, Cinder is an exceptional restaurant that delivers traditional fine dining in a relaxed and welcoming environment. If you're looking for an unforgettable dining experience in Melbourne, look no further than Queens Street's very own Cinder.
